Most of us are familiar with the idea of membership because of our involvement in clubs or teams or even a local gym.  At its most basic level, membership means that you belong.

Most people don’t know that membership is a concept that originates with the Church.  The apostle Paul was the first to refer to people who put their trust in Jesus as “members of the body”.  He said that the way we relate to one another and are connected to one another in Jesus was just like how the parts of our bodies relate to and are connected to one another.  Like the parts of the body we’re different, but we need each other to be the church that Jesus intends us to be.  So, on one level, membership is simply about saying “I’m connected.  I belong.”  The basis of that connection though is something much deeper.

What connects us in the church is our relationship to Jesus.  When we claim that relationship, we not only bind ourselves to Jesus, but also to Jesus’ people.   Membership in the church therefore also involves a claim of faith – a readiness to say that we belong to Jesus, that He is our Saviour and Lord.
